How our Commercial & Business Risk Mitigation can help with your business growth journey:

  • Anti-bribery/corruption - within local and international markets
  • Transaction risk analysis - supporting both buyer and supplier side in commercial negotiations and contract term optimisation
  • Corporate governance: a multi-stakeholder approach that covers communications, lobbying and activist engagement 
  • Business operations and insurance risk analysis - assessing potential litigation that may arise through business operations and assessing against relevant insurances such as employer’s liability, public liability and professional indemnity insurances
  • Public sector specialism - we have a unique and proven relationship with public sector clients - from large central government departments to regional and local government
  • Cybersecurity and privacy - we have detailed working knowledge of GDPR and the UK GDPR. We can assess risk from your digital operations and consult to help put in place safeguarding and preventative measures in conjunction with dependable, accredited technology partners
